Editor’s Note: Since Hyperliquid launched HyperEVM, its ecosystem has been rapidly expanding, with projects in DeFi, GameFi, and more emerging one after another. SMooTH has reviewed the GameFi and SocialFi projects in Hyperliquid that are still in the early stages and has classified them based on factors such as project development progress, influence, and product quality. Odaily will provide additional information about these early projects in this article for readers' reference.
A-Class GameFi Project
These projects demonstrate real potential; they may still be in the early stages or lack a feature or two, but the vision for the projects is already present, and their execution is equally impressive. If they further improve (or build up a player base), they can develop rapidly.
808 FLIP: An NFT-based coin flipping game with profit sharing.
808 FLIP allows users to play a coin toss game on-chain, where players can bet any amount of HYPE on either heads or tails each time, and then click "Flip" to see the result. At the same time, holding the official NFT earns profit-sharing. On July 3, the project completed its second round of profit distribution. The game combines classic guessing mechanics with Web3 incentive mechanisms, providing simple gameplay and platform profit-sharing. However, the following regions are not allowed to play on 808 Flip: Australia, Aruba, Bonaire, Curacao, France, Netherlands, Saba, Spain, St. Maarten, United Kingdom, United States.
808 Flip has also launched a points and rebate system, where referrers can earn 10% of points and transaction fees from their friends.
Genesy: A P2E strategy game built around optimizing chips.
Genesy is a P2E strategy game on the Hyperliquid platform where players can upgrade and optimize their "Genesy chips" to increase the production rate of GENESY tokens. This "chip" consists of 9 customizable components. Therefore, the project can be simply understood as an "on-chain mining machine project"; when GENESY tokens are profitable, players are motivated to continuously upgrade their "chips". However, it is still in the early stages, and the chip upgrade feature is not yet available.
30% of the Genesy token will be produced by players, 7% belongs to the development fund, 7% is allocated to strategic partners, 10% is reserved, 10% is distributed to the team, and 36% is used for ecosystem growth.
Kittykingdom: An on-chain PvP adventure game using hero NFTs
Kittykingdom is a fully on-chain battle adventure game built on Hyperliquid, featuring elements such as quests, PVP and PVE, and pets. Currently, there are a total of 20,000 hero NFTs in the game, each priced at $100, and players can only start the game by purchasing a hero. The official team will use 50% of the funds from selling heroes to buy back KITTY tokens, 20% for game development, 10% as game rewards, 10% for airdrops, and 10% as referral rewards. However, as of now, only 59 NFTs have been sold.
KITTY is the governance token of the game, with a total supply of 100 million tokens. The team retains 20%, and the remaining 80% was fairly launched through hypurr.fun, winning the Hyperliquid spot auction on April 14, 2025. Gold is the utility token in the game, generated entirely through PVP games, with a total supply of 1 billion tokens.

B-Class GameFi Projects
These projects are either not officially launched yet or are in a development dilemma. However, if they can complete Beta testing, they also have good potential.
Yolo.ex: A sci-fi adventure game combined with real DeFi trading
Yolo.ex integrates game storylines with trading strategies in a futuristic world, where players make real on-chain transactions in a 3D game, and their trading decisions will affect the plot development. The game is built on Hyperliquid and has been launched in early access on Epic Games.
Vegas: A crypto poker platform with no house rake.
Vegas is a decentralized poker game running on Hyperliquid, currently in beta testing phase. It supports tournaments and sports betting, characterized by real stakes, fair competition, and on-chain transparency. According to the official announcement, the game will have its first test on July 11 and July 12.
But Vegas does not use HYPE or stablecoins as betting funds, but rather its platform token VEGAS. This token has been launched on the Hyperliquid spot market, with a market value of 4.86 million dollars.

Horsy.games: A combination of NFT horse racing and on-chain DeFi
Horsy.games is an on-chain horse racing game where players can buy, sell, and race NFT horses. It successfully combines betting, staking, and trading features through a liquidity pool of HORSY tokens and USDC, similar to Zed Run, but the difference is that Horsy.games is HyperLiquid native.
The HORSY token was launched on HyperEVM on June 25, with a current market value of $983,000 according to Dexscreener data.
Chain Tactics: A 1v1 strategy game similar to chess.
Chain Tactics integrates tactical role-playing game elements with chess-style combat in a 1v1 format. The game is developed by Sovrun (formerly BreederDAO) and is said to still be in production (a recent post on platform X was released on February 5, 2025).
SocialFi Projects on HyperLiquid (Level B)
These applications are attempting to attract users, incentivize engagement, and build community infrastructure in new ways. Although it is still in its early stages, creativity is continuously emerging.
HyperRaid: Raid-to-earn mode
HyperRaid rewards users for completing social and on-chain tasks for supported ecosystem projects, gamifying tasks, lotteries, and whitelist spots into a community-driven growth engine. Currently, there are 13 projects that have launched social tasks on HyperRaid.
Fan App: A creator-fan platform with inherent crypto nature.
The Fan App helps creators share research, alpha, and insights with the community. Community members access it through Creator Keys—this is a permissionless way to directly monetize valuable information on Hyperliquid.
Summary
Although HyperLiquid was born for trading, this has not stopped developers from being creative. From RPG games that integrate DeFi elements to creator monetization applications, this ecosystem has demonstrated a diversity that goes beyond market and analyst research.
Although most of these projects are still in their early stages, some have already gone live and are continuously growing. Nevertheless, this indicates that the significance of Hyperliquid goes far beyond just a perpetual contract liquidity pool.
